The Journal
of the American Psychoanalytic Association (JAPA) is the preeminent North
American psychoanalytic scholarly journal in terms of number of subscriptions,
frequency of citation in other scholarly works and the preeminence of its
authors.
Published bimonthly, this peer-reviewed publication is an invaluable resouce for
psychoanalysts, psychologists, psychiatrists, and other mental health
professionals. APsaA member Steven T. Levy, M.D. serves as editor of JAPA.
JAPA publishes original articles, research, plenary presentations, panel
reports, abstracts, commentaries, editorials and correspondence. In addition,
the JAPA Review of Books provides in-depth reviews of recent literature.
